The Rise of RMG in Bangladesh

A. Historical Background

Bangladesh, post-independence, faced economic challenges until the emergence of the RMG industry. Initially known for jute exports, the nation sought a new avenue for global trade.

B. Current Economic Landscape

As of 2024–2024, Bangladesh boasts an impressive GDP of $446.349 billion, with the RMG sector contributing approximately 10% and accounting for 82% of total exports.

Importance of the Garments Industry in Bangladesh in 2024

A. Employment Generation

The RMG industry is a major source of employment, providing economic empowerment to over four million Bangladeshis, with nearly 60% being women.

B. Export Revenue

Bangladesh’s competitive labor costs and favorable trade policies led to a substantial increase in global clothing exports, reaching $45 billion in 2024.

C. Foreign Exchange Earnings

The industry significantly contributes to foreign exchange reserves, vital for maintaining a favorable trade balance.

D. Contribution to GDP

In the fiscal year 2024, the clothing industry made up about 9.25% of Bangladesh’s total economic output.

E. Poverty Alleviation

By offering job opportunities, especially to those from low-income backgrounds, the RMG industry has played a role in poverty reduction.

F. Global Competitiveness

Bangladesh’s garments industry has become globally competitive, exporting garments worth $45 billion in the fiscal year 2024–22.

The Top 20 Garment Factories in Bangladesh

A. Ha-meem Group

1.1 Overview Ha-Meem Group stands out as a leading wholesale garments manufacturer globally, with a reputation for stylish denim fabrics.

1.2 Achievements

  • Founded in 1984 by Mr. A. K. Azad and Mr. Delwar.
  • Employs approximately 50,000 workers.
  • Monthly production capacity of 7 million pieces.

B. Beximco Apparels Limited

2.1 History and Development

  • Started in March 1985 as Comtrade Apparels Limited.
  • Renamed Beximco Apparels Limited on January 1, 1997.

2.2 Export Focus

  • Specializes in producing 8+ million high-quality apparel for men, women, and children.

C. Square Fashions Ltd.

3.1 Entrance into Textile Business

  • Entered the textile business in 1997 with Square Textiles Ltd., a yarn manufacturing company.

3.2 Production Capacities

  • Daily production capacities of 60,000 and 45,000 pieces in Garments Unit-1 and Unit-2, respectively.
  • Produces 39.5 tons of fabrics per day.

D. DBL Group

4.1 Inception

  • Began its journey in 1991 under Dulal Brothers Limited.

4.2 Key Partnerships

  • Trusted partner for renowned brands such as H&M, Walmart-George, Puma, and Esprit.

How to Choose the Best Garment Factory in Bangladesh

A. Reputation

  • Assess the factory’s reputation through reviews, testimonials, and client feedback.

B. Compliance and Certification

  • Ensure the factory complies with industry regulations and possesses relevant certifications.

C. Quality Control

  • Evaluate the factory’s approach to quality control to ensure garments meet required standards.

D. Production Capacity

  • Consider the factory’s production capacity and its alignment with your volume needs.

E. Infrastructure and Technology

  • Inspect the factory’s infrastructure and technology for efficient and high-quality production.

F. Cost and Pricing

  • Balance affordability and quality, evaluating overall cost structures.

G. Communication and Transparency

  • Choose a factory with open and honest communication for a successful partnership.
